Problems solved by technology

[0003] The fruiting bodies of chanterelles contain many types of fungi and a large number of bacteria. Due to the restriction of the culture technology of the strains, the artificial domestication and cultivation of chanterelles has not made breakthrough progress.
As a result, its development and utilization are limited to wild resources, so that the development and utilization of chanterelles resources is basically in the state of "natural growth, free collection, and spontaneous trade". Every harvest season, people who collect chanterelles collect chanterelles in a predatory manner , has seriously damaged the natural environment on which chanterelles depend for their survival and growth. The production of chanterelles has been decreasing year by year, and in some areas they are even facing the situation of extinction.

Embodiment 2

[0020] A method for artificial domestication and cultivation of wild chanterelles, comprising the steps of:

[0021] (1) Separation and cultivation of strains: collect wild chanterelle fruiting bodies, take 1500ml of filtrate after cleaning, add 20g of sucrose, 20g of yeast extract, 2.0g of potassium dihydrogen phosphate, 1.0g of magnesium sulfate, 25g of agar, adjust the pH to 7 with phosphate buffer , after making a slant and inoculating it, culture it at a constant temperature of 20°C until the mycelia cover the slant;

[0022] ⑵Original seed culture: Inoculate 20.4g of the mother seed into a test tube for culture based on dark culture at 28°C, and the mycelia can be covered to the bottom of the bottle; Gypsum 10g, wheat bran 20g, calcium superphosphate 8g, sucrose 10g, urea 10g, vitamin B1.0g, peptone 15g, set the volume at 1000ml, pH5.0, sterilize with high-pressure steam at 0.15 and 130°C for 30min;

Abstract

The invention discloses an artificial domestication cultivation method for wild chanterelle, and relates to the technical field of edible mushroom cultivation. The wild chanterelle serving as a strain is obtained by strain separation and artificial domestication cultivation of stock cultures and cultivated species, so that wild resources of the species are protected, the supply of the market species of rare chanterelle is enriched, and higher economical and social benefits are achieved; meanwhile, the artificial domestication cultivation method is simple, low in pollution, pure in strain and easy to operate; by the adoption of a unique bagged material cultivation method, the cultivation period is shortened; the obtained stain is inoculated to cultivation mycelium, so that the germination rate is 82.5 percent, which is higher than that of the conventional method (56.5 percent) by 26 percent; therefore, the artificial domestication cultivation method is worth to be popularized and applied industrially.

Description

technical field [0001] The invention relates to the technical field of cultivation of edible fungi, in particular to a method for artificial domestication and cultivation of wild chanterelles. Background technique [0002] Chanterelles (Cantharelles cibarius Fr.) is one of the world's famous edible fungi, fruit body fleshy, trumpet-shaped, apricot yellow to egg yellow, fungus meat egg yellow, strong aroma, with almond flavor, tender and delicate, delicious, also known as Egg yolk, apricot fungus. The cap is 3-9cm in diameter, initially flat and then concave, with wavy edges, often cracked and involuted. The stipe is solid and smooth, 2-6cm long and 0.5-1.8cm in diameter. It is famous for being rich in vitamin A. According to the data, the protein content is 21.4%, the crude fat is 4.3%, the carbohydrate is 65.7%, the cellulose is 11.2%, and contains 18 kinds of amino acids, among which the human body has a high content of 8 kinds of amino acids.
